#416b1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#416b1d is composed of 25.5% red, 42%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 26.7%. #416b1d color hex could be obtained by blending #82d63a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#416b1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#416b1d has RGB values of R:65, G:107,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4287261.

Shades and Tints of #416b1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#416b1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444642 is the less saturated color, while #3f8503 is the most saturated one.
